Background technology
Cyperus has another name called Cyperus esculentus L. Var. Sativus Baeck, originates in African northeast, and cyperus is sedge family annual herb vegetable oil material crop, and the system of fibrous root, blade is long narrow hard, and there is cuticula on surface.Cyperus is wide to soil suitability, but the most suitable with sandy soil, earth, black earth and loessal soil.Composition contained by cyperus is: fat 20% ~ 30%, starch 25% ~ 30%, sugar 12% ~ 30%, resin 7%, cellulose 3%.Every 100 kilograms of cyperus can be extracted oil 18 ~ 20 kilograms (, in faint yellow, quality is suitable with peanut oil for oil), and every 100 kilograms of the soya-bean cake after oil expression can refine starch 25 ~ 30 kilograms.Cyperus also can be made wine, and every 100 kilograms of raw materials can make 60 degree of white wine 30 ~ 40 kilograms, and every 100 kilograms of the grain after wine brewing can endure maltose 30 ~ 40 kilograms.The stem of the slag grain that the grouts after oil expression, wine brewing are remaining and cyperus, leaf are the good feeds of livestock.
Due to the many merits of above-mentioned cyperus, obtain popularizing planting more and more widely at present, in view of this, be badly in need of a kind of cyperus harvester device to replace the mode of operation of hand harvest, improve results speed, make cyperus be able to popularizing planting more widely.

During use, cyperus harvester and tractor are used, reaping machine pull bar 2 are articulated on tractor, then by the diesel engine of transmission case power shaft 1 and tractor or independently engine be connected by jockey.Start tractor and engine, the broken standing grain of trimming is thrown device 4 and is pulled up by crop with delivery sheet 5 acting in conjunction, and crop is by being sent into screen mesh type conveyer bucket 25 by soil recovering device 6 above delivery sheet 5.In process, the perforate above delivery sheet 5 can be separated the part earth that crop is taken out of.Screen mesh type conveyer bucket 25 turns to above eccentric vibrating screen 23 under the effect of chain 7, crop in screen mesh type conveyer bucket 25 is poured on eccentric vibrating screen 23, eccentric vibrating screen 23 does not stop vibrations under the effect of eccentric wheel 24, is transported to by crop on horizontal screen cloth 14.In process, leave less gap between the metallic rod on eccentric vibrating screen 23, the earth that crop is carried is separated further.Turn over grass wheel 18 crop on horizontal screen cloth 14 is pulverized further, lighter crops straw is siphoned away by blower fan, cyperus is fallen on the reciprocal plansifter 10 of elongated hole by larger gap between the metallic rod on horizontal screen cloth 14, cyperus is delivered to out in beans spiral organ 9 by the reciprocal plansifter 10 of elongated hole, going out beans spiral organ 9 is transported to bottom vertical discharge barrel 22 by cyperus, cyperus is upwards delivered to discharging opening 1 place by vertical discharge barrel 22.A small amount of granule earth that cyperus can be carried by the sieve aperture 8 bottom vertical discharge barrel 22 is separated.The earth fallen below eccentric vibrating screen 23 is transferred band 19 and is fed forward to discharge below frame 12.
